1 y separately published work icon The Research Laurent Boulanger , United States of America (USA) : Lake Ozark Press , 2018 19724749 2018 single work novel

'Nathan is convinced his partner Lucia is cheating on him; Lucia is having an affair with Lorenzo, a man half her age; Lorenzo is sleeping with his friend, Tom; Tom is kicked out of home and seduces Walter to get free shelter; Walter is no longer in love with Marilyn; Marilyn cannot accept rejection. Six interconnected people are interviewed about their most intimate secrets and opinions of love for a university research project. Everything is recorded on camera. Suspicion about the research's underlying intentions for the recordings is aroused when one of the lovers commits suicide and Lucia becomes pregnant. With the recordings acting as a catalyst, the lovers question whether the information they first gave freely is now controlling them.'

(Source: publisher's blurb)

1 y separately published work icon The Novelist Laurent Boulanger , Lake Ozark Press , 2016 19724982 2016 single work novella

'2016 WINNER Grand Prize (Top Honor), Pacific Rim Book Festival

'2016 WINNER Best General Fiction, Pacific Rim Book Festival

'Lewis was a good-selling writer once, a mid-list writer, as they call them in the industry, basically one who sells enough books to keep on-board, but not so many he becomes rich out of it. But now that he is older, his books no longer sells, and his girlfriend is tired of being with someone who is always broke. When his publisher takes his next novel without an advance and insists on publishing it as an e-book only, Lewis is forced to take on a creative teaching job at the local community college to make ends meet. He meets a young woman writer filled with talent who begins to take over his mind and his life. At the crossroad of possibilities, Lewis must decide to continue with writing or give it up forever.'

(Source: publisher's blurb)
